WebA new acute case is an incident case that is over the age of 36 months and has not previously been reported meeting case criteria for chronic hepatitis C or for whom there is laboratory evidence of re-infection. These suspect case classifications are intended solely for internal health department surveillance tracking purposes and not for official case counts at the state ... sigman researchWebAcute and Chronic Revised CSTE Case Definitions Effective 01/01/2016 Prepared by … sigman realty asbury park njWebJun 6, 2024 · CDC/CSTE Acute Hepatitis C Case Definition. Clinical Criteria for Diagnosis. An acute illness with a discrete onset of any sign or symptom* consistent with acute viral hepatitis (e.g., fever, headache, malaise, anorexia, nausea, vomiting, diarrhea, and abdominal pain), and either a) jaundice, or b) elevated serum alanine aminotransferase … sigmans roofing texasWebCSTE updated the case definition for Candida auris, with reporting and specimen submission required under Washington Administrative Code 246-101.
